Seating is limited and will be available on a first come\, first served basis. \n  \nBill Mechanic is Chairman and CEO of Pandemonium Films and is currently in Australia filming THE MOON AND THE SUN\, starring Pierce Brosnan and William Hurt. Through Pandemonium\, he has produced the Oscar-nominated CORALINE\, THE NEW WORLD and DARK WATER. \n	Prior to forming Pandemonium\, he was chairman and CEO of Twentieth Century Fox Filmed Entertainment\, where he oversaw all operations of the studio including worldwide feature film production\, marketing and distribution activities. During his tenure the company produced such hit films as TITANIC (which became the highest-grossing film in history)\,BRAVEHEART\, CAST AWAY\, X-MEN\, INDEPENDENCE DAY\, THERE’S SOMETHING ABOUT MARY\, BOYS DON’T CRY\, SPEED\, THE THIN RED LINE and MOULIN ROUGE! among many others. Under Mr. Mechanic\, Fox became the number one studio in worldwide box-office gross in 1998\, producing the number one-grossing movie worldwide for three consecutive years: DIE HARD WITH A VENGEANCE\, INDEPENDENCE DAY and TITANIC. Fox also earned 42 Oscar nominations and 2 Best Picture Oscars during his tenure. \n	Prior to Fox\, Mr. Mechanic served as president of international distribution and worldwide video at Walt Disney Studios\, where he oversaw international theatrical\, worldwide home video\, and worldwide pay television. Under him\, the company’s home video division grew from $30 million in revenue to over $3 billion in revenue. While at the helm of Disney he also set up Buena Vista International\, the first completely new international theatrical distribution organisation in more than three decades.
